MTR OF CHANG IL MOON v. DSS


207 A.D.2d 103 (1995)

In the Matter of Chang Il Moon, Respondent, v. New York State Department of Social Services, Appellant

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, Third Department.

January 5, 1995


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Dennis C. Vacco, Attorney-General, Albany (Frank K. Walsh and Peter G. Crary of counsel), for appellant.

Rubin & Shang, Albany (Gayle A. O'Brien of counsel), for respondent.

MIKOLL, MERCURE, CASEY and YESAWICH JR., JJ., concur.


CARDONA, P. J.

During the course of an administrative hearing challenging respondent's determination to terminate petitioner's status as a participating provider in New York's Medical Assistance Program, petitioner served two subpoenas duces tecum seeking production of two of respondent's employees, together with any documents within their control that were relevant to the determination.
